Output d2b3677fc935561d519520bb071f008855f58f6ed3a0e8e4f4be540a21113b65:2

value
515172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a15f0fa4bb1eed0dba82137827ec52de281ab2a OP_EQUAL
address
344wn3KwZ9revv2tvqhqLtLB1rj2Tv2KaY
transaction
d2b3677fc935561d519520bb071f008855f58f6ed3a0e8e4f4be540a21113b65
spent
true